Nestled in the heart of West Virginia's Boone County, Forks of Coal is a small community rich in Appalachian history and natural beauty. While it offers a peaceful environment, understanding local safety is important for residents and visitors alike. Tips for Staying Safe in Forks of Coal
Enhance your safety with simple precautions:
- Stay Informed: Regularly check the crime map and local news updates.
- Report Suspicious Activity: Contact Boone County law enforcement to report any concerns.
- Secure Your Property: Lock doors and windows, and consider security cameras.
- Community Engagement: Participate in neighborhood watch programs to strengthen community bonds.
